免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

java开发一个app步骤

Java开发一个APP的步骤可以分为以下几个阶段:需求分析、设计阶段、编码阶段和测试阶段。下面我将详细介绍每个阶段的内容。

一、需求分析阶段:

1.明确需求:与客户进行沟通,了解他们的期望和需求。明确功能、设计和用户界面等方面的要求。

2.需求分析:根据需求进行分析,确定APP开发的主要功能和模块。制定开发计划和时间表。

二、设计阶段:

1.系统架构设计:设计APP的整体架构,确定模块之间的关系和数据交互方式。

2.数据库设计:根据需求分析,设计数据库表结构,确定数据模型和关系。选择适当的数据库管理系统。

3.界面设计:根据需求和用户体验,设计合适的用户界面,包括布局、样式和交互等方面。

4.算法设计:根据功能需求,设计合适的算法,保证程序的运行效率和准确性。

三、编码阶段:

1.环境准备:安装Java开发环境,包括JDK、开发工具(如Eclipse或IntelliJ IDEA)等。

2.编写代码:根据设计阶段的设计文档和需求分析,逐步编写代码实现功能。遵循良好的编码规范和设计模式。

3.数据交互:根据设计的数据库模型,编写代码实现数据的增删改查,确保数据的安全性和一致性。

4.界面实现:根据设计的用户界面,编写代码实现界面的布局和交互逻辑。保证用户体验的友好和流畅。

四、测试阶段:

1.单元测试:对应用程序的小模块进行测试,检查每个模块是否达到设计和功能要求。

2.集成测试:将各个模块整合测试,确保模块之间的协同工作。

3.系统测试:对整个系统进行功能测试,检查是否满足需求,发现并修复潜在的问题。

4.性能测试:对系统进行负载测试,检查系统的性能和可靠性。

5.用户验收测试:将应用交由客户进行测试,获得反馈并做必要的修改。

五、发布和上线:

1.部署:将应用程序部署到服务器或云平台。

2.优化:对程序进行性能优化,提高用户体验。

3.发布:发布应用程序,供用户下载和使用。

以上就是Java开发一个APP的详细步骤。希望对您有所帮助。


相关知识:
青浦区创新手机app开发程序
随着智能手机的普及,手机应用程序也越来越多,满足了人们在生活和工作中的各种需求。而开发手机应用程序的过程中,程序的原理和技术也越来越多元化。在青浦区,有很多公司和个人在开发手机应用程序,从而满足人们在生活和工作中的需求。下面我将详细介绍青浦区创新手机app
2024-01-10
h5开发手机app工具
HTML5开发手机App工具是一种使用HTML、CSS和JavaScript等Web开发技术来创建跨平台移动应用程序的工具。它的原理是通过使用Web浏览器的功能来访问设备的原生API和功能,从而允许在多个移动平台上运行应用程序。下面将详细介绍HTML5开发
2023-07-14
app软件开发产品认知
APP软件开发是指基于移动设备的应用程序开发,通过编写代码和设计界面,实现特定功能和服务的软件产品。在现代社会中,APP已经成为人们生活和工作的重要组成部分,涵盖了各个领域,如社交媒体、电子商务、健康管理等。APP软件开发的原理可以概括为以下几个方面:1.
2023-06-29
app开发套用模板
在移动应用开发领域,使用模板是一种常见的开发方法。模板是一种预先设计好的界面布局和功能组件,开发者可以根据自己的需求进行定制和修改,从而快速构建出符合自己需求的应用程序。使用模板可以大大减少开发时间和工作量,提高开发效率。下面我将详细介绍一下使用模板开发移
2023-06-29
app开发报价单需求
在当今科技飞速发展的时代,移动应用已经成为人们日常生活中不可或缺的一部分。从购物、社交、娱乐到工作、学习,移动应用几乎无处不在。许多企业和个人也陆续开始开发自己的应用,以便为用户提供便捷的服务。但是,在开发一个应用之前,我们需要明确我们的需求,并了解开发过
2023-06-29
app建模开发系统
移动应用程序开发平台(Mobile Application Development Platform,MADP)是一个综合性的开发平台,允许公司和企业建立、测试、调试和发布移动应用程序,用于Android、iOS、Windows Phone等多种平台,可以
2023-05-06